NO TERRITORIAL EXCHANGE TO BE DISCUSSED IN GENEVA
H. Aliyev and R. Kocharian will not discuss the issue of territorial exchange in their next meeting in Geneva, says Azeri Foreign Minister Guliyev.
Asked what Azerbaijan expects from the Geneva talks, the minister said Azerbaijan has demands to put forward and "we are going to Geneva to defend them", he said.
DEFENSE MINISTRY DELEGATION IN PAKISTAN
A Defense Ministry delegation led by Colonel-General Safar Abiyev is paying a familiarization visit to Pakistan on the invitation of the country's government. The visit agenda includes meetings with the head of the executive power committee of Pakistani General Pervez Musharraf, ministers of defense, foreign affairs, internal affairs, oil and natural resources. The visit is scheduled to last till May 25.
OIL AND GAS SUMMIT DUE IN ASTRAKHAN
An international oil and gas summit "Caspian XXI: from politics to business" is due in Astrakhan, Russia, on May 24, as SOCAR president Natig Aliyev is expected to make a presentation on Azerbaijan's experience. Reports on political aspects of cooperation in the Caspian basin will be delivered by diplomats from five littoral countries.
Discussions will also center on Caspian legal status, investment climate, exploration and production, marketing, export routes, environmental issues, etc. The summit is co-sponsored by SOCAR.
TENDER FOR SUPPLY OF GAS-METERING STATIONS DUE IN JUNE
A tender for the supply of gas-metering stations will be held in June, according to the "AzeriGas" joint stock company. One of the two gas metering stations to be purchased will be installed on the gas pipeline on the border with Russia and the other - with Georgia. The currently used stations have become obsolete and need to be replaced.
The European Commission has allocated Euro2 million for the purchase of the stations, therefore, tender results will have to be approved by the EC.
